Job description

JOB SUMMARY

Responsible for all aspects of the site (location, branch) operations, safety, staffing, and customer service functions working in conjunction with the Sales and Supply Chain teams. Leads the local team to manage safety and compliance performance, packaged gas sales, welding products, hard goods sales, cylinder production and distribution. Required for all jobs.

  • Performs other duties as assigned.
  • Complies with all policies and standards.

EDUCATION

Bachelor’s Degree from a four‑year college or university preferred.

WORK EXPERIENCE

Five to ten years of related experience and/or training preferably in site/branch operations and/or package gas operations in the industrial gas industry; or an equivalent combination of education and experience.

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S, ABILITIES
  • Certificates, licenses, registrations:
    • Valid driver’s license.
    • Hazardous materials training.
  • Proficient with computer software programs such as Microsoft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Outlook.
  • Hands‑on understanding of industrial gas products, production, and distribution applications, and associated equipment.
  • Working knowledge of Six Sigma and Lean manufacturing practices.
  • Training in Safety and Compliance (OSHA, DOT, EPA, and FDA).
